What is an AI CRM for real estate investor relations? AI CRM real estate investor relations is a customer relationship management platform enhanced with artificial intelligence that helps commercial real estate sponsors, syndicators, and fund managers automate LP communications, track investor interactions, and manage capital raising workflows with greater efficiency than traditional CRM systems. These platforms combine contact management with predictive analytics, automated communication scheduling, and intelligent deal pipeline tracking. Why CRE Investors Need AI Enhanced CRM

Commercial real estate investing is fundamentally a relationship business. Sponsors who raise capital from limited partners, syndicators who manage investor communications across multiple offerings, and fund managers who maintain ongoing LP relationships all depend on consistent, personalized communication to retain investors and attract new capital. As portfolios grow and investor bases expand, maintaining this communication quality becomes exponentially more difficult.

Traditional CRM platforms store contact information and track interactions but require manual effort for every communication, follow up, and report distribution. AI enhanced CRMs transform this relationship management by automating routine communications, predicting investor behavior, and generating personalized content at scale. The result is investor relations that feels personal and attentive even as your investor base grows from dozens to hundreds of LPs.

The financial impact is measurable. Sponsors using AI CRM platforms report faster capital raises because their outreach is better targeted and timed. Investor retention rates improve because automated touchpoints prevent the communication gaps that erode LP confidence. And administrative overhead decreases, freeing sponsor time for the strategic relationship building that no AI can replicate. Top AI CRM Platforms for CRE Investors

1. InvestNext

InvestNext is purpose built for real estate syndicators and fund managers. Its AI features include automated distribution calculations, intelligent investor communication scheduling, and predictive analytics for capital raising. The platform combines CRM functionality with investor portal capabilities, allowing LPs to log in and view their investment performance, distribution history, and offering documents.

Key AI features include automated K1 distribution and tax document delivery, AI generated investor update drafts based on property performance data, smart segmentation that groups investors by investment preferences and historical participation, and predictive scoring that identifies investors most likely to commit to your next offering. Pricing starts at approximately $150 per month with tiered plans based on the number of investors and active offerings.

2. Juniper Square

Juniper Square offers institutional grade investor management with AI capabilities designed for commercial real estate GPs and fund managers. The platform handles capital raising, investor communications, fund administration, and performance reporting in an integrated environment. Its AI layer automates document processing, investor onboarding, and performance analytics.

AI capabilities include automated capital call and distribution processing, intelligent document extraction and organization, AI powered investor matching for new offerings based on historical preferences, and automated compliance monitoring for Reg D and other securities exemptions. Juniper Square targets mid market to institutional operators with pricing typically starting at $300 or more monthly, reflecting its comprehensive feature set.

3. HubSpot CRM with AI Features

HubSpot's general purpose CRM platform provides a cost effective AI CRM option for emerging sponsors who need core relationship management without industry specific features. HubSpot's free tier includes contact management, email tracking, and basic pipeline management. The paid tiers at $50 to $150 per month add AI features like predictive lead scoring, automated email sequences, and AI content generation for communications.

For CRE investors, HubSpot works best when customized with industry specific properties, pipelines, and automation workflows. Create custom deal pipelines for capital raising stages, configure investor segmentation based on investment amount and asset class preferences, and build email automation sequences for onboarding, quarterly updates, and distribution notifications. The platform lacks real estate specific features like distribution calculations or investor portals but compensates with flexible customization and lower cost. 4. AppFolio Investment Manager

AppFolio Investment Manager combines property management capabilities with investor relations CRM functionality. The platform's AI features bridge the gap between operational data and investor communications, automatically generating performance reports from property management data and distributing them to relevant investors. This integration eliminates the manual data transfer between property management and investor reporting systems.

AI capabilities include automated performance report generation from operational data, intelligent maintenance and capex alerts for investor transparency, AI drafted investor communications based on property performance triggers, and automated waterfall distribution calculations with investor specific breakdowns. AppFolio is particularly strong for operators who also use AppFolio for property management, creating a unified platform for operations and investor relations. Pricing is typically in the $200 to $400 monthly range depending on portfolio size.

5. Salesforce with CRE Customization

Salesforce's Einstein AI provides enterprise grade CRM intelligence that sophisticated CRE operators can configure for investor relations. While Salesforce requires significant customization for real estate applications, its AI capabilities are among the most advanced available. Einstein AI provides predictive opportunity scoring, automated activity logging, intelligent workflow recommendations, and natural language querying of your investor database.

The advantage of Salesforce is scalability and integration breadth. Hundreds of third party apps connect to Salesforce, enabling integration with virtually any other platform in your tech stack. For institutional operators managing complex fund structures with hundreds of LP relationships, Salesforce's flexibility justifies its higher price point of $75 to $300 or more per user monthly plus customization costs.

Key Features to Evaluate

AI Communication Automation

The most impactful AI CRM feature for CRE investors is communication automation. Evaluate how each platform handles automated investor update generation from property performance data, smart scheduling that sends communications at optimal times based on investor engagement patterns, AI drafted email content that maintains your voice while personalizing for each investor segment, and triggered communications based on events like distributions, capital calls, or significant property milestones.

The best platforms generate first draft communications that require minimal editing, saving hours per update cycle while maintaining the personal touch that investors value. Test this capability during platform evaluation by providing sample property data and reviewing the quality of AI generated communications.

Predictive Analytics for Capital Raising

AI powered predictive analytics transform capital raising from a broadcast exercise into a targeted process. Key predictive features include investor commitment probability scoring for upcoming offerings, optimal ask amount recommendations based on investor history and capacity, timing predictions for when investors are most likely to commit, and churn risk scoring that identifies investors who may be disengaging from your communications.

These predictions enable sponsors to prioritize their limited time on the investor relationships with the highest conversion probability and tailor their approach to each investor's preferences and capacity. Capital raises that previously required broad outreach to the entire investor base become targeted campaigns focused on the most likely participants.

Reporting and Distribution Automation

For sponsors managing multiple active offerings, automated reporting and distribution calculations save substantial time each quarter. Evaluate how platforms handle automated waterfall distribution calculations with configurable deal structures, investor specific reporting showing individual contribution, distributions received, and current IRR, automated K1 and tax document distribution, and performance dashboards that investors can access through a self service portal. Integration with your accounting system is critical for this feature category. Platforms that require manual data entry for distribution calculations defeat the purpose of automation.

Implementation Strategy

Data Migration and Setup

Migrating from spreadsheets or a basic CRM to an AI powered platform requires careful data preparation. Clean your investor database before migration by verifying contact information and standardizing data fields. Map your existing investor segments and communication preferences to the new platform's categorization structure. Import historical interaction data to give the AI models training data for predictive features.

Plan for a 2 to 4 week implementation period that includes data migration, workflow configuration, team training, and parallel operation with your existing system. Do not cut over to the new platform until you have verified that all investor data transferred accurately and automated workflows produce correct outputs.

Workflow Configuration

Configure your AI CRM workflows to match your current investor relations process before attempting to optimize them. Map each step of your capital raising pipeline, quarterly reporting cycle, and ongoing investor communication cadence into the platform's workflow engine. Once the existing process is automated and functioning correctly, begin using AI recommendations to optimize timing, content, and targeting.

Team Adoption

AI CRM platforms deliver value only when your team uses them consistently. Invest in training that focuses on the specific workflows each team member will use daily rather than comprehensive platform training. Assign a platform champion who maintains configurations, monitors AI recommendation quality, and trains new team members. Track adoption metrics for the first 90 days and address usage gaps before they become entrenched habits.

Measuring ROI

Track the return on your AI CRM investment through quantifiable metrics. Measure time saved on investor communications per quarter compared to your previous process. Track capital raise velocity by measuring days from offering launch to fully subscribed for offerings before and after CRM implementation. Monitor investor retention rate changes and average re up rates across offerings. Calculate administrative cost reduction from automated distribution calculations and report generation.

Most sponsors see positive ROI within the first capital raise conducted on the new platform. The combination of faster capital raising, improved investor retention, and reduced administrative overhead typically provides 3 to 5x return on the annual platform cost.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: At what point does an AI CRM become necessary for a real estate sponsor?

A: Most sponsors benefit from an AI CRM once they manage 30 or more investor relationships across two or more active offerings. Below this threshold, spreadsheets and basic email tools handle the communication volume adequately. Above it, the complexity of tracking individual investor preferences, managing multiple offering timelines, and maintaining consistent communication quality exceeds what manual processes can reliably deliver.

Q: Can AI CRM platforms handle the compliance requirements of securities offerings?

A: Purpose built CRE investor CRM platforms like InvestNext and Juniper Square include compliance features for Reg D offerings, accredited investor verification tracking, and subscription document management. General purpose CRMs like HubSpot require third party integrations or manual processes for securities compliance. Verify specific compliance capabilities during platform evaluation, as regulatory requirements vary by offering structure and jurisdiction.

Q: How do AI CRM platforms protect sensitive investor data?

A: Enterprise CRE CRM platforms implement bank grade encryption, SOC 2 compliance, role based access controls, and regular security audits. Before selecting a platform, review its security certifications, data residency policies, and breach notification procedures. For platforms handling accredited investor information and investment documents, security infrastructure should be a primary evaluation criterion rather than an afterthought.

Q: Will investors notice or appreciate AI automated communications?

A: Well implemented AI communications are indistinguishable from manually crafted messages. The best AI CRM platforms generate communications in your voice and style, personalized with investor specific details like their investment amount, distribution history, and property exposure. Investors notice and appreciate the consistency and timeliness of communications rather than the underlying technology. The risk is poorly configured AI that produces generic or incorrect communications, which is why careful setup and ongoing quality monitoring are essential.

Q: How long does it take to see results from an AI CRM implementation?

A: Operational efficiency improvements in communication automation and report generation are visible within the first month. Predictive analytics features require 2 to 3 months of data accumulation before producing reliable predictions. Capital raising impact typically becomes measurable on your next offering after implementation. Most sponsors report the platform paying for itself within the first quarter of active use through time savings alone, with capital raising improvements providing additional ROI in subsequent quarters.
